Oconee County Middle School is a lower-poverty, mid-sized middle school in Watkinsville, Georgia, enrolling 940 students.
Class loads run somewhat heavier than typical: 15.7:1 puts it in the larger third of Georgia schools by student-teacher ratio.
Comparatively few students face economic hardship here, 10.4% free-meal eligibility runs 83% below the Georgia average.
Enrollment of 940 puts it in the larger third of Georgia sch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 2,314 scored Georgia schools.
Among 212 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Georgia schools statewide, it ranks #178,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is predominantly White (80% of enrollment) (diversity index 34/100).
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 470 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Attendance runs somewhat below the norm, with 19.3% of students chronically absent per the 2021-22 civil-rights collection.
Oconee County also operates North Oconee High School (1,432 students) and Oconee County High School (1,313 students) alongside Oconee County Middle School.
